A private off-court conversation shared between tennis players has unexpectedly become a major talking point online, highlighting the blurred lines between personal and public life in the sport. The incident involves Russian player Veronika Kudermetova and Danish star Holger Rune, and originated from Elena Vesnina's "Spring Is Calling" podcast.

Private Chat Goes Public: The Podcast Leak

Veronika Kudermetova recently found herself at the centre of unwanted online attention after a story she believed was private was included in a published podcast episode. The anecdote, which involved a social media interaction with the 22-year-old Holger Rune, was shared by Kudermetova with host Elena Vesnina before the official interview began, while cameras were still being set up.

Kudermetova explained to reporters that she was "really upset" when the segment aired, as it was never meant for public consumption. She expressed discomfort at subsequently meeting Rune at tournaments, feeling the private moment had been exposed. According to her account, Rune had simply messaged her on social media, to which she replied that she was married and older, and both shared a laugh before the matter ended.

Reactions and Ripples Across the Tennis World

The fallout from the leaked story was swift. The incident sparked widespread discussion among fans and media about how players interact privately. Podcast host Elena Vesnina defended her show's editorial process, telling TENNIS.com that she works closely with guests and would not intentionally release content they did not approve. She described the situation as having "got out of control" and attracting more attention than anticipated.

Adding fuel to the fire, fellow player Anna Kalinskaya referenced similar experiences with unsolicited messages in a separate interview, further amplifying the social media conversation around player boundaries.

Rune's Response and Cultural Context

Holger Rune, who is currently recovering from an Achilles heel injury that may delay his start to the 2026 season, addressed the topic directly on social media. His response attempted to provide context, suggesting that cultural differences may have influenced how the story was perceived. This intervention helped shift some of the online discourse from criticism towards a more nuanced understanding of the innocent interaction.
